Savannah stands out for local-taxi-excursions due to its compact Historic District, where taxis, trolleys, and ferries weave through 22 tree-canopied squares without needing a car. This setup lets visitors chase hidden gems like tucked-away galleries and off-path eateries via quick, narrated rides that locals favor. Prime experiences include trolley loops from Forsyth Park to River Street, vintage car spins past haunted mansions, and ferry jaunts along the bustling port. Venture to perimeter spots via taxi for indie bookshops and street art, or pair rides with food tours at soulful diners. These excursions hit architecture, history, and Lowcountry vibes in paced, story-filled segments.
Spring and fall deliver ideal 70°F days with low humidity; summers swelter, winters chill mildly. Expect easy taxi hails downtown, free shuttles, and rideshares everywhere. Prep with booked tours, comfortable layers, and cash for seamless navigation.

Book trolley tours or vintage car rides a day ahead via apps or hotel concierges, especially for groups, to lock in morning slots when crowds thin. Time excursions for 9 AM starts to beat heat and hit prime squares before noon. Negotiate taxi fares upfront for off-script detours to lesser-known spots like perimeter gems.
Download offline maps and the DOT shuttle app for seamless hops between taxi drop-offs and ferries. Carry cash for tips and small vendors, plus a portable charger for constant photo-snapping. Wear layers for air-conditioned rides turning humid outdoors.
